Making a screen shot is very useful for web design and other communication.
There are several ways of doing it.
Here is a process that is known to work on all windows based computers:
Arrange the screen to show the windows and other dialogs you need in your picture.
Press the print screen button, usually in the upper right of the keyboard.
Right click in the directory you want your picture in
Choose NEW and then Bitmap Image
Rename the picture to something descriptive, such as directoryscreenshot.bmp
Right click on the picture, choose EDIT
The picture should open in Paint
Go to the edit menu and paste your image
Your whole computer screen will show up in the paint document, the whole image will be selected.
Change from the selection tool to any other tool to unselect the picture
Go back to the rectangular select tool.
Select the part of the image that you want in your final image.
Copy the selection
Close without saving
Edit the document again and paste the cropped image into it.
Save the file.
To get a JPG, you should choose save as, and for file type, choose jpg
Now you have a custom screenshot of something on your computer.
You can use this image as a picture on a web page, upload it to flickr, picasa or do other fun things with it.
